Pat Gustavson and Mignon Weisinger Papers

 Collection
Identifier: 2017-025
Dates: 1940s-2010s
Preliminary Scope and Contents Note

The personal papers of life partners Pat Gustavson, an architect and pediatric hematologist, and Mignon Weisinger, an artist, in Houston and Galveston. The papers document their life partnership, early and family lives, education, careers, and community.

UH LGBTQ+ Resource Center Records

 Collection
Identifier: 2015-015
Dates: 2008-2023; undated
Scope and Contents The UH LGBTQ+ Resource Center Records includes analog and electronic material from 2008-2023 that document the formation and functions of the Center. The collection consists of annual reports, brochures, and news articles related to events, policies, and programs, including Cougar Ally Training, Rainbow Coogs, Rainbow Friends, Lavender Graduation, and Mentorship. Edward Lukasek Oral History Interview

 Item
Identifier: 2018-015
Dates: August 10, 2017
Content Description

The oral history of Edward Lukasek was recorded on August 10, 2017, at the University of Houston Libraries-Special Collections. His interview describes his life and his experiences of coming out, and also how he formed his LGBT book collection.

Annise Parker Papers

 Collection
Identifier: 2008-004
Dates: 1991-2001
Scope and Contents This collection is housed in 9 boxes and the arranged in 7 series. Annise Parker’s papers document her campaigns for elected office in the City of Houston from: City Council Race-Defeated-1991; City Council Race-Defeated-1995; City Council Race-Won-1997; City Council Race-Won-2001; City Controller Race-Won-2003; and City Controller Race-Won-2005. Frank Parsley Papers

 Collection — Box 1-26
Identifier: 2024-011
Dates: approximately 1980-2023
Content Description

The collection mostly contains items that document the creator’s personal life and his work as a photographer. The printed photographs, photo slides, and photo negatives feature images of family, friends and others, landscapes, flowers, animals, local/regional Pride events, and activism. Also in the collection are VHS tapes, protest posters, a t-shirt from the 1989 March on the Capitol, buttons, books, American Gay Atheist newsletters, erotica, pornography, and medical records.

Ray Hill Papers

 Collection
Identifier: 2017-048
Dates: 1940-2020; Majority of material found within 1985-2018
Scope and Contents The Ray Hill Papers date from 1940 to 2020. The collection consists primarily of letters written to Hill (from prisoners held in Texas prisons) while he was host of The Prison Show that airs on 90.1 FM KPFT. Created by Hill, the show discusses prisoners rights and issues within the criminal justice system. There are also letters written to Hill from friends and family members of prisoners.
